Context: The Data Methodology To understand the asymmetry, we must track the cost and complexity of each component. The Arena-M system relies on a millimeter-wave radar, a high-speed computer, and a launcher with interceptor rockets. Each unit costs roughly $300,000 to $500,000. The drone, by contrast, uses commercial off-the-shelf parts: a carbon fiber frame, an electric motor, a flight controller, and a camera. The total bill of materials: under $2,000. The exchange rate is 250-to-1. But the strategic resource is not dollars—it’s the ability to iterate. The drone’s software can be updated weekly. The APS firmware is locked in a six-month certification cycle. The ledger shows who controls the pace of innovation.

Contrarian: Correlation ≠ Causation The military pundits are quick to declare the death of the tank. But correlation is not causation. The drone’s success against the APS is a function of the specific tactical environment: low electronic warfare density, clear weather, and a swarm that overwhelmed the radar’s tracking capacity. In a high-EW environment, the drone’s GPS link would fail, and the APS would regain its edge.
